Output 2aba2907c788286a51cbb33536ed0ee886c0f9a03c9708852b81668b09bba526:14

value
94572705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2aeda50eecef699e5e4b3d9a39c14d83673fa0 OP_EQUAL
address
3EU9x7NELMKxEinb9VS942R2PosSMacaQm
transaction
2aba2907c788286a51cbb33536ed0ee886c0f9a03c9708852b81668b09bba526
spent
true